Special day for me
I recently joined this forum because I finally said to myself "It's time you did something nice for yourself." I've had a bit of a rough year. Earlier in the year my business took a hit. Then in the spring I suffered a bit of a freak injury. I ruptured my right bicep tendon while bowling (yes, you can laugh). I was ushered into semi-emergency surgery 3 days later to reattach it. I recovered, toughed it out. Business recovered as well.
Ever since I was a younger man in my 20's I wanted a Rolex Submariner. I was very specific with my desires. I wanted a no date, two line, 14060. I know it's humble but it's what I wanted. I'm a very laid back and subtle guy and I felt this watch would be best for me. Well today Ian, royaloak36, made it happen for me. Thanks again for your professionalism and helping me acquire something I've wanted for a very long time. Cheers. P serial, very nice condition. EDIT: Sorry for the pic size initially, gentlemen. |
